Multiple start schemas on Tabular model

  • Dear all,

    I have speaking with people that defend that even using tabular model we could and should instead of using one start schema with some facts, use isntead multiple start schemas (according to the granularity of users needs).

    Arguments is that it is better for performance and access management. As each group of users can use is start schema according to thir granularity and have access only to it. 

    According to what I saw , it seems that we can even have just one datamart with multiple start schemas Vs multiple start schemas each one representing a data mart.

    Can you please point me to a document that has this explanation according to tabular? I though that this was only possible for multidimensional . But it seems tabular can and should also benefit from it.

    I guess that this is the difference between imon and kimball?

    Thank you.

  • river1 - Friday, July 6, 2018 12:11 PM

    Dear all,

    I have speaking with people that defend that even using tabular model we could and should instead of using one start schema with some facts, use isntead multiple start schemas (according to the granularity of users needs).

    Arguments is that it is better for performance and access management. As each group of users can use is start schema according to thir granularity and have access only to it. 

    According to what I saw , it seems that we can even have just one datamart with multiple start schemas Vs multiple start schemas each one representing a data mart.

    Can you please point me to a document that has this explanation according to tabular? I though that this was only possible for multidimensional . But it seems tabular can and should also benefit from it.

    I guess that this is the difference between imon and kimball?

    Thank you.

    As always, the answer is "it depends".
    😎

    How much data overlap would there be if separated into multiple star schemas?
    Tabular models do not necessarily have to be star schema models and access can be controlled by row level access using i.e. roles.

  • I don't expet to havemuch more data. but more data will  needed.

    Solution is composed by:

    1 staging area , one data mart one tabular cube.

    We have one start schema with some facts.

    We expect our DBs to go above 1 TB of information.

    I believe that I can have (even wit tabular) multiple start schemas, each with one with one or two facts. and have just one data mart to old it all. or, have one data mart per each of the start schemas.
    But I don't understand the advantages of this. In tabular should I have just one DM ?

    Thanks

Viewing 3 posts - 1 through 2 (of 2 total)

You must be logged in to reply to this topic. Login to reply